About This Opportunity
A postgraduate research scholarship providing up to $140,000 stipend to support PhD students at the Faculty of Engineering, University of Sydney. This scholarship is designed to support research into developing embrittlement-tolerant alloys for safe hydrogen transmission and storage. Australia has committed to achieving a carbon-free economy by 2050, and replacing fossil fuels with clean hydrogen fuel is key to this transition. However, conventional steels fracture easily when they come into contact with hydrogen. This project aims to develop new steels that are safe to use in high-pressure hydrogen pipes, focusing on understanding the interaction between steel microstructure and hydrogen, ultimately enabling the production of a safe gas infrastructure necessary for a hydrogen economy. This prestigious scholarship is supported by the Deputy Vice-Chancellor (Research) of the University of Sydney as part of an Australian Research Council Linkage Project. The selected researcher will be involved in a collaborative network, including international steel manufacturers and world-leading researchers, with opportunities to attend international conferences.

Review process
Selection based on demonstrated academic achievement, research experience, curriculum vitae, area of study and/or research proposal, personal statement demonstrating interest in the research project, and interview. Preference given to applicants with a minimum overall undergraduate mark of 80 (scale of 100 pass mark of 50) or equivalent.
